2 Welcome to The Chief of the Royal Norwegian Air Force s Air Power Conference 2017 It is with great pleasure that the Air Force Academy, on behalf of the Chief of the Royal Norwegian Air Force, welcomes you all to this year s Air Power Conference here in Trondheim. The topic of the 2017 conference is the possibilities and challenges that the introduction of new platforms and technology presents to the Norwegian Air Force in particular, and the Norwegian Armed Forces in general. Strategic Air Force planners have claimed that the procurement of a capability like the F-35 Joint Strike Fighter is a key element for the defense of Norway s interests in the future. However, in order for the F-35 to realize its full potential, and become the Shield and Sword of Norway, it will also demand a development of the surrounding and supporting systems into what has been termed a 5th Generation Air Force. 5th has been launched as a term for the desired future state of the Norwegian Air Force. This necessarily implies that we will have to change and adapt in order to exploit the full potential of this platform and other new systems in a joint and combined future environment. The conference is therefore aimed at shedding light on the implications this challenge might entail, for the Air Force, but also inevitably for the other Services and the Joint community. Several questions arise. What will be the role of the new aircraft? Do we have the right concepts, procedures, technology, organization and competence in order to utilize the aircraft? What will be Norway s defense structure and doctrine in the future? What will be the balance between national defense and international operations?
